20090089761METHOD, SYSTEM AND COMPUTER PROGRAM FOR DEBUGGING SOFTWARE APPLICATIONS IN A WEB ENVIRONMENT - A method and system are provided for debugging a software application in a data processing system that includes a server entity and client entities. For at least one of the client entities, a server component of the application running on the server entity is accessed, and a client component of the application is downloaded from the server entity. The client component is executed. Client log information relating to the execution of the client component is saved by invoking a log function provided by the client component; the client log information is saved into a non-persistent memory structure of the client component. The client log information is transmitted for use in the debugging of the application.04-02-2009

20080228902Configuring processing entities according to their roles in a data processing system with a distributed architecture - A mechanism is provided for configuring different computers of a network. Each computer plays a specific physic role (defined by an architecture of the network) and/or a specific logic role (defined by the applications running in the network). A reference model and a transition table are associated with each product to be installed in the network; the reference model specifies a target configuration for each role (defined by the components of the product to be installed), while the transition table specifies the actions required to reach each target configuration from each current configuration of the computers. A server identifies the role and the current configuration of each computer; the actions required to enforce the desired target configuration on the computer are then established and executed.09-18-2008

20080229303METHOD, SYSTEM AND COMPUTER PROGRAM FOR DISTRIBUTING CUSTOMIZED SOFTWARE PRODUCTS - A solution for distributing software products in a data processing system is disclosed. A set of models of each software product is to be distributed (for example, of the UML type) is provided; each model includes an indication of relationships among a plurality of available logical items (representing functions provided by the software product, such as use cases) and a plurality of available distribution artifacts (used to distribute the software product). A set of logical items is then selected among the available ones. The process continues by identifying a set of distribution artifacts required to implement the selected logical items (among the available distribution artifacts); the required distribution artifacts are identified according to the corresponding relationships in the models. A software package is built including the required distribution artifacts. The software package is then distributed to a set of data processing entities of the system (i.e., endpoints), so as to cause each entity to install the required distribution artifacts on the entity.09-18-2008
